Transaction 246a24d708886fa995795f786123262c478d1a7698304aa8f2579e9d406e714c

1 Input
2 Outputs
  • 246a24d708886fa995795f786123262c478d1a7698304aa8f2579e9d406e714c:0
  • value  29664138
    address  3CfMAAM1u9rk76fisQKwFmsGcYC2pRXFzD
  • 246a24d708886fa995795f786123262c478d1a7698304aa8f2579e9d406e714c:1
  • value  4956692
    address  1GWxaHgguxmbRJXHnX37oaDBXfvLiMvPGZ